This year's winner of the Peace Prize of the German Book Trade 2023 is Mumbai-born writer Salman Rushdie.

Born on 19 June 1947 in Bombay (now Mumbai, India), Sir Salman Ahmed Rushdie is one of the outstanding writers of contemporary English-language literature. His works, which have been translated into more than 40 languages, often combine magical realism with historical fiction. They cover topics such as connections, migration, and cultural differences between Eastern and Western civilizations, and are often set on the Indian subcontinent. In addition to novels, Rushdie also writes short stories, travelogues, essays and journalistic contributions.

Salman Rushdie celebrated his 76th birthday on the day of the announcement and was delighted to receive the award. His breakthrough came with the book "Midnight Children" (promotional link), which was awarded the prestigious Booker Prize in 1981. In it, he tells the story of India's secession from the British Empire.

From 2004 to 2006, Salman Rushdie held the position of President of the PEN American Center and was then Chairman of the PEN World Voices International Literary Festival for ten years. His literary work and his social commitment have been honored with numerous international awards. In 2007, he was made a Knight Bachelor by Queen Elizabeth II and knighted.

Salman Rushdie was stabbed by an assailant on stage at an event in upstate New York on August 12, 2022, shortly after completing his novel "Victory City" and suffered life-threatening injuries. Although Rushdie survived the assassination attempt, he lost an eye and his writing hand was permanently impaired. The release of "Victory City" in early 2023, a utopian story that deals with themes such as abuse of power and love and tells of a remarkable rise and fall of a city, was given an additional oppressive dimension by the attack, which is anchored in today's reality.

In early June 2023, Salman Rushdie announced that he wanted to write a book about the assassination attempt that was perpetrated on him, according to Penguin Verlag.
